Trending: Remington 1100 Left Hand Barrels


Trending: Remington 1100 Left Hand Barrels

A shotgun barrel designed for a Remington 1100 and configured for left-handed shooters ejects spent shells to the left side of the receiver. This configuration is crucial for safe and comfortable operation, preventing ejected shells from striking the face or obstructing the shooter’s view. This specific barrel type is designed to be compatible with the Remington 1100, a popular gas-operated semi-automatic shotgun known for its reliability and smooth recoil.

Specialized barrels like these significantly enhance the shooting experience for left-handed individuals. They address the safety concerns and distractions associated with standard right-handed ejection patterns, allowing for more focused and accurate shooting. The availability of such components reflects the firearms industry’s increasing recognition of the needs of left-handed shooters, historically an underserved segment of the market. This accommodation contributes to inclusivity and enables a wider range of individuals to participate in shooting sports comfortably and safely.

M4 Barrel Length: Specs & Sizes Explained


M4 Barrel Length: Specs & Sizes Explained

The standard measurement for the M4 carbine’s barrel is 14.5 inches. This dimension is a key factor influencing the weapon’s overall handling characteristics, including its maneuverability in close quarters and its effective range. Civilian-legal versions often feature a 16-inch barrel to comply with regulations. This slight difference can impact ballistic performance.

This specific dimension is a crucial design element carefully balanced against factors like portability and ballistic effectiveness. A shorter barrel enhances maneuverability in confined spaces, making the weapon ideal for close-quarters combat and urban operations. However, a longer barrel generally contributes to higher muzzle velocity and improved accuracy at longer ranges. The chosen length reflects a compromise optimized for the M4’s intended role. Historically, this length resulted from extensive testing and analysis to find the optimal balance between these competing needs for a versatile infantry weapon.

Trending: Glock G23 9mm Barrel Upgrade Kit


Trending: Glock G23 9mm Barrel Upgrade Kit

A factory or aftermarket conversion component allows the Glock 23, originally chambered in .40 S&W, to fire 9x19mm Parabellum cartridges. This typically involves a simple barrel swap, though some users may also opt for new magazines optimized for 9mm ammunition reliability. This conversion offers a cost-effective way to enjoy the versatility of a common and less expensive cartridge while retaining the familiar platform.

Adapting the .40 caliber pistol to 9mm provides several advantages. Lower ammunition costs contribute to more frequent practice, and reduced recoil can improve accuracy and control, particularly for newer shooters. The widespread availability of 9mm ammunition is also a significant benefit. Historically, caliber conversions have been a popular way for firearms owners to expand the capabilities of their existing handguns. This practice allows for flexibility in ammunition choice and cost savings without the need to purchase an entirely new firearm.
